Keith Edward Root
Keith Root began his Tai Chi journey in 1993. He briefly studied Wu Style before finding his way home with Yang family Tai Chi Chuan. He started with Chen Man Cheng’s short form before learning Doc Fai Wong’s short and intermediate forms, and two weapon forms; the sword and fan. Presently, Keith is continuing his study of Yang style Tai Chi Chuan and Yi-Quan with Fong Ha. Keith is certified in the Tai Chi for Arthritis and Tai Chi for Diabetes programs and is very active with the local Arthritis Foundation chapter. Keith was recently appointed as Senior Trainer by the Tai Chi for Arthritis program in 2007.
